What instruments do you teach?
Violin (All Levels) and Viola (Beginner)
What styles of music do you enjoy teaching and playing?
Western classical music, indian classical music, jazz and bluegrass.
How long have you taught music?
10 years.
What are your qualifications and experience?
I just returned from a summer of teaching violin and the Himalayan Mountains. I've been playing violin since age 4. I began my training with the Black Hills Suzuki School. Over the years I've performed with the Black Hills Symphony, the Black Hills Chamber Orchestra, the Central High School Chamber Orchestra and rock/bluegrass groups around the country. I studied violin at Peabody Conservatory from 2005-2007. Future plans include returning to India to study Hindustani Classical music.
What do you enjoy the most about giving lessons?
I love the 'ah ha' moment, when a student's eyes light up with the realization of the endless possibilities they can create on their instrument. It's the point where a piece becomes more than notes on a page; when the work of a great master is reborn with their unique and diverse interpretations. From simple Twinkle-Twinkle Lisste Star to the Bruch Violin Concerto, I focus on strengthening technique with Western Classical reqertoire while nuturing the musicality inherent in each student at every level.
